dev:修改字段

main
SondonYong 2025-12-02 17:56:40 +08:00
parent dc9840c477
commit f1ddba3960
15 changed files with 24 additions and 26 deletions

View File

@ -7,7 +7,6 @@ import com.zcloud.basic.info.dto.UserChangeRecordPageQry;
import com.zcloud.basic.info.dto.UserChangeRecordListQry; import com.zcloud.basic.info.dto.UserChangeRecordListQry;
import com.zcloud.basic.info.dto.UserChangeRecordUpdateCmd; import com.zcloud.basic.info.dto.UserChangeRecordUpdateCmd;
import com.zcloud.basic.info.dto.UserChangeRecordRemoveCmd; import com.zcloud.basic.info.dto.UserChangeRecordRemoveCmd;
import com.zcloud.basic.info.dto.clientobject.UserChangeRecordCO;
import com.alibaba.cola.dto.MultiResponse; import com.alibaba.cola.dto.MultiResponse;
import com.alibaba.cola.dto.PageResponse; import com.alibaba.cola.dto.PageResponse;
import com.alibaba.cola.dto.Response; import com.alibaba.cola.dto.Response;
@ -20,8 +19,6 @@ import lombok.AllArgsConstructor;
import org.springframework.validation.annotation.Validated; import org.springframework.validation.annotation.Validated;
import org.springframework.web.bind.annotation.*; import org.springframework.web.bind.annotation.*;
import java.util.ArrayList;
/** /**
* web-adapter * web-adapter
* *

View File

@ -1,7 +1,6 @@
package com.zcloud.basic.info.command; package com.zcloud.basic.info.command;
import com.zcloud.basic.info.domain.gateway.UserChangeRecordGateway; import com.zcloud.basic.info.domain.gateway.UserChangeRecordGateway;
import com.zcloud.basic.info.domain.model.UserChangeRecordE;
import com.zcloud.basic.info.dto.UserChangeRecordAddCmd; import com.zcloud.basic.info.dto.UserChangeRecordAddCmd;
import com.alibaba.cola.exception.BizException; import com.alibaba.cola.exception.BizException;
import lombok.AllArgsConstructor; import lombok.AllArgsConstructor;

View File

@ -2,7 +2,6 @@ package com.zcloud.basic.info.command;
import com.alibaba.cola.exception.BizException; import com.alibaba.cola.exception.BizException;
import com.zcloud.basic.info.domain.gateway.UserChangeRecordGateway; import com.zcloud.basic.info.domain.gateway.UserChangeRecordGateway;
import com.zcloud.basic.info.domain.model.UserChangeRecordE;
import com.zcloud.basic.info.dto.UserChangeRecordUpdateCmd; import com.zcloud.basic.info.dto.UserChangeRecordUpdateCmd;
import lombok.AllArgsConstructor; import lombok.AllArgsConstructor;
import org.springframework.beans.BeanUtils; import org.springframework.beans.BeanUtils;

View File

@ -1,7 +1,5 @@
package com.zcloud.basic.info.command.convertor; package com.zcloud.basic.info.command.convertor;
import com.zcloud.basic.info.dto.clientobject.UserChangeRecordCO;
import com.zcloud.basic.info.persistence.dataobject.UserChangeRecordDO;
import org.mapstruct.Mapper; import org.mapstruct.Mapper;
import java.util.List; import java.util.List;

View File

@ -4,8 +4,6 @@ import com.alibaba.cola.dto.MultiResponse;
import com.zcloud.basic.info.command.convertor.UserChangeRecordCoConvertor; import com.zcloud.basic.info.command.convertor.UserChangeRecordCoConvertor;
import com.zcloud.basic.info.dto.UserChangeRecordPageQry; import com.zcloud.basic.info.dto.UserChangeRecordPageQry;
import com.zcloud.basic.info.dto.UserChangeRecordListQry; import com.zcloud.basic.info.dto.UserChangeRecordListQry;
import com.zcloud.basic.info.dto.clientobject.UserChangeRecordCO;
import com.zcloud.basic.info.persistence.dataobject.UserChangeRecordDO;
import com.zcloud.basic.info.persistence.repository.UserChangeRecordRepository; import com.zcloud.basic.info.persistence.repository.UserChangeRecordRepository;
import com.zcloud.gbscommon.utils.PageQueryHelper; import com.zcloud.gbscommon.utils.PageQueryHelper;
import com.alibaba.cola.dto.PageResponse; import com.alibaba.cola.dto.PageResponse;

View File

@ -10,7 +10,6 @@ import com.zcloud.basic.info.dto.UserChangeRecordAddCmd;
import com.zcloud.basic.info.dto.UserChangeRecordPageQry; import com.zcloud.basic.info.dto.UserChangeRecordPageQry;
import com.zcloud.basic.info.dto.UserChangeRecordListQry; import com.zcloud.basic.info.dto.UserChangeRecordListQry;
import com.zcloud.basic.info.dto.UserChangeRecordUpdateCmd; import com.zcloud.basic.info.dto.UserChangeRecordUpdateCmd;
import com.zcloud.basic.info.dto.clientobject.UserChangeRecordCO;
import com.alibaba.cola.dto.PageResponse; import com.alibaba.cola.dto.PageResponse;
import com.alibaba.cola.dto.SingleResponse; import com.alibaba.cola.dto.SingleResponse;

View File

@ -5,7 +5,6 @@ import com.zcloud.basic.info.dto.UserChangeRecordAddCmd;
import com.zcloud.basic.info.dto.UserChangeRecordPageQry; import com.zcloud.basic.info.dto.UserChangeRecordPageQry;
import com.zcloud.basic.info.dto.UserChangeRecordListQry; import com.zcloud.basic.info.dto.UserChangeRecordListQry;
import com.zcloud.basic.info.dto.UserChangeRecordUpdateCmd; import com.zcloud.basic.info.dto.UserChangeRecordUpdateCmd;
import com.zcloud.basic.info.dto.clientobject.UserChangeRecordCO;
import com.alibaba.cola.dto.PageResponse; import com.alibaba.cola.dto.PageResponse;
import com.alibaba.cola.dto.SingleResponse; import com.alibaba.cola.dto.SingleResponse;

View File

@ -12,7 +12,7 @@ import java.time.LocalDate;
* web-client * web-client
* *
* @Author SondonYong * @Author SondonYong
* @Date 2025-12-02 14:08:18 * @Date 2025-12-02 17:54:06
*/ */
@Data @Data
public class UserChangeRecordCO extends ClientObject { public class UserChangeRecordCO extends ClientObject {
@ -29,8 +29,8 @@ public class UserChangeRecordCO extends ClientObject {
@ApiModelProperty(value = "变更时间") @ApiModelProperty(value = "变更时间")
@J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ss") @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
private LocalDateTime changeTime; private LocalDateTime changeTime;
//入职状态1-在职 0-离职, 2-入职待审核, 3-离职待审核 //入职状态1-待审批, 2-通过
@ApiModelProperty(value = "入职状态1-在职 0-离职, 2-入职待审核, 3-离职待审核") @ApiModelProperty(value = "入职状态1-待审批, 2-通过")
private Integer status; private Integer status;
//变更前企业id //变更前企业id
@ApiModelProperty(value = "变更前企业id") @ApiModelProperty(value = "变更前企业id")
@ -50,6 +50,9 @@ public class UserChangeRecordCO extends ClientObject {
//变更前负责岗位名称 //变更前负责岗位名称
@ApiModelProperty(value = "变更前负责岗位名称") @ApiModelProperty(value = "变更前负责岗位名称")
private String postNameBefore; private String postNameBefore;
//变更前状态
@ApiModelProperty(value = "变更前状态")
private Integer userStatusBefore;
//变更后企业id //变更后企业id
@ApiModelProperty(value = "变更后企业id") @ApiModelProperty(value = "变更后企业id")
private Long corpinfoIdAfter; private Long corpinfoIdAfter;
@ -68,4 +71,7 @@ public class UserChangeRecordCO extends ClientObject {
//变更后负责岗位名称 //变更后负责岗位名称
@ApiModelProperty(value = "变更后负责岗位名称") @ApiModelProperty(value = "变更后负责岗位名称")
private String postNameAfter; private String postNameAfter;
//变更后状态
@ApiModelProperty(value = "变更后状态")
private Integer userStatusAfter;
} }

View File

@ -1,7 +1,5 @@
package com.zcloud.basic.info.domain.gateway; package com.zcloud.basic.info.domain.gateway;
import com.zcloud.basic.info.domain.model.UserChangeRecordE;
/** /**
* web-domain * web-domain
* *

View File

@ -9,7 +9,7 @@ import java.util.Date;
* web-domain * web-domain
* *
* @Author SondonYong * @Author SondonYong
* @Date 2025-12-02 14:08:18 * @Date 2025-12-02 17:54:06
*/ */
@Data @Data
public class UserChangeRecordE extends BaseE { public class UserChangeRecordE extends BaseE {
@ -21,7 +21,7 @@ public class UserChangeRecordE extends BaseE {
private Long userId; private Long userId;
//变更时间 //变更时间
private Date changeTime; private Date changeTime;
//入职状态1-在职 0-离职, 2-入职待审核, 3-离职待审核 //入职状态1-待审批, 2-通过
private Integer status; private Integer status;
//变更前企业id //变更前企业id
private Long corpinfoIdBefore; private Long corpinfoIdBefore;
@ -35,6 +35,8 @@ public class UserChangeRecordE extends BaseE {
private Long postIdBefore; private Long postIdBefore;
//变更前负责岗位名称 //变更前负责岗位名称
private String postNameBefore; private String postNameBefore;
//变更前状态
private Integer userStatusBefore;
//变更后企业id //变更后企业id
private Long corpinfoIdAfter; private Long corpinfoIdAfter;
//变更后企业名称 //变更后企业名称
@ -47,5 +49,7 @@ public class UserChangeRecordE extends BaseE {
private Long postIdAfter; private Long postIdAfter;
//变更后负责岗位名称 //变更后负责岗位名称
private String postNameAfter; private String postNameAfter;
//变更后状态
private Integer userStatusAfter;
} }

View File

@ -1,8 +1,6 @@
package com.zcloud.basic.info.gatewayimpl; package com.zcloud.basic.info.gatewayimpl;
import com.zcloud.basic.info.domain.gateway.UserChangeRecordGateway; import com.zcloud.basic.info.domain.gateway.UserChangeRecordGateway;
import com.zcloud.basic.info.domain.model.UserChangeRecordE;
import com.zcloud.basic.info.persistence.dataobject.UserChangeRecordDO;
import com.zcloud.basic.info.persistence.repository.UserChangeRecordRepository; import com.zcloud.basic.info.persistence.repository.UserChangeRecordRepository;
import lombok.AllArgsConstructor; import lombok.AllArgsConstructor;
import org.springframework.beans.BeanUtils; import org.springframework.beans.BeanUtils;

View File

@ -13,7 +13,7 @@ import java.util.Date;
* web-infrastructure * web-infrastructure
* *
* @Author SondonYong * @Author SondonYong
* @Date 2025-12-02 14:08:19 * @Date 2025-12-02 17:54:06
*/ */
@Data @Data
@TableName("user_change_record") @TableName("user_change_record")
@ -29,8 +29,8 @@ public class UserChangeRecordDO extends BaseDO {
//变更时间 //变更时间
@ApiModelProperty(value = "变更时间") @ApiModelProperty(value = "变更时间")
private Date changeTime; private Date changeTime;
//入职状态1-在职 0-离职, 2-入职待审核, 3-离职待审核 //入职状态1-待审批, 2-通过
@ApiModelProperty(value = "入职状态1-在职 0-离职, 2-入职待审核, 3-离职待审核") @ApiModelProperty(value = "入职状态1-待审批, 2-通过")
private Integer status; private Integer status;
//变更前企业id //变更前企业id
@ApiModelProperty(value = "变更前企业id") @ApiModelProperty(value = "变更前企业id")
@ -50,6 +50,9 @@ public class UserChangeRecordDO extends BaseDO {
//变更前负责岗位名称 //变更前负责岗位名称
@ApiModelProperty(value = "变更前负责岗位名称") @ApiModelProperty(value = "变更前负责岗位名称")
private String postNameBefore; private String postNameBefore;
//变更前状态
@ApiModelProperty(value = "变更前状态")
private Integer userStatusBefore;
//变更后企业id //变更后企业id
@ApiModelProperty(value = "变更后企业id") @ApiModelProperty(value = "变更后企业id")
private Long corpinfoIdAfter; private Long corpinfoIdAfter;
@ -68,6 +71,9 @@ public class UserChangeRecordDO extends BaseDO {
//变更后负责岗位名称 //变更后负责岗位名称
@ApiModelProperty(value = "变更后负责岗位名称") @ApiModelProperty(value = "变更后负责岗位名称")
private String postNameAfter; private String postNameAfter;
//变更后状态
@ApiModelProperty(value = "变更后状态")
private Integer userStatusAfter;
public UserChangeRecordDO(String userChangeRecordId) { public UserChangeRecordDO(String userChangeRecordId) {
this.userChangeRecordId = userChangeRecordId; this.userChangeRecordId = userChangeRecordId;

View File

@ -1,6 +1,5 @@
package com.zcloud.basic.info.persistence.mapper; package com.zcloud.basic.info.persistence.mapper;
import com.zcloud.basic.info.persistence.dataobject.UserChangeRecordDO;
import com.baomidou.mybatisplus.core.mapper.BaseMapper; import com.baomidou.mybatisplus.core.mapper.BaseMapper;
import org.apache.ibatis.annotations.Mapper; import org.apache.ibatis.annotations.Mapper;

View File

@ -1,6 +1,5 @@
package com.zcloud.basic.info.persistence.repository; package com.zcloud.basic.info.persistence.repository;
import com.zcloud.basic.info.persistence.dataobject.UserChangeRecordDO;
import com.alibaba.cola.dto.SingleResponse; import com.alibaba.cola.dto.SingleResponse;
import com.alibaba.cola.dto.PageResponse; import com.alibaba.cola.dto.PageResponse;
import com.jjb.saas.framework.repository.repo.BaseRepository; import com.jjb.saas.framework.repository.repo.BaseRepository;

View File

@ -1,7 +1,6 @@
package com.zcloud.basic.info.persistence.repository.impl; package com.zcloud.basic.info.persistence.repository.impl;
import com.jjb.saas.framework.repository.common.PageHelper; import com.jjb.saas.framework.repository.common.PageHelper;
import com.zcloud.basic.info.persistence.dataobject.UserChangeRecordDO;
import com.zcloud.basic.info.persistence.mapper.UserChangeRecordMapper; import com.zcloud.basic.info.persistence.mapper.UserChangeRecordMapper;
import com.zcloud.basic.info.persistence.repository.UserChangeRecordRepository; import com.zcloud.basic.info.persistence.repository.UserChangeRecordRepository;
import com.alibaba.cola.dto.SingleResponse; import com.alibaba.cola.dto.SingleResponse;